是指当父元素没有设置固定的宽度和高度时,子元素的内容超出父元素的边界而导致溢出的情况。
这种情况下,子元素的内容会根据其自身的大小来撑开父元素,如果子元素的内容超出了父元素的边界,就会溢出显示在父元素之外。
解决这个问题的方法有多种,以下是一些常见的解决方案:
- 使用CSS的overflow属性:可以通过设置overflow属性为"auto"或"scroll"来为父元素添加滚动条,这样当子元素的内容超出父元素时,用户可以通过滚动条来查看溢出的内容。
- 使用CSS的white-space属性:可以通过设置white-space属性为"nowrap"来防止子元素的内容换行,这样当内容超出父元素时,会自动缩小内容以适应父元素的宽度。
- 使用CSS的text-overflow属性:可以通过设置text-overflow属性为"ellipsis"来在内容溢出时显示省略号,这样可以提醒用户有内容被隐藏,并且可以通过鼠标悬停或点击来查看完整的内容。
- 调整子元素的大小或布局:可以通过调整子元素的大小或布局来确保其内容不会超出父元素的边界,例如使用CSS的max-width属性限制子元素的最大宽度。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云云服务器(CVM):提供弹性计算能力,满足各种业务需求。详情请参考:https://cloud.tencent.com/product/cvm
- 腾讯云对象存储(COS):提供安全、稳定、低成本的云端存储服务,适用于图片、音视频、文档等各类文件的存储和管理。详情请参考:https://cloud.tencent.com/product/cos
- 腾讯云云数据库MySQL版(TencentDB for MySQL):提供高性能、可扩展的MySQL数据库服务,适用于各种规模的应用场景。详情请参考:https://cloud.tencent.com/product/cdb_mysql
- 腾讯云内容分发网络(CDN):提供全球加速、高可用的内容分发服务,加速网站、图片、音视频等静态资源的传输。详情请参考:https://cloud.tencent.com/product/cdn